作者:刘伯韬 人气:19
以下是一个 31 岁制定有效的前端职业发展规划的建议:
一、自我评估1. 自己当前的技能水平,包括掌握的前端技术栈、项目经验等。
2. 明确自身优势,如技术专长、沟通能力、团队协作能力等。
3. 分析自身不足,可能包括某些技术的欠缺、管理经验不足等。
二、目标设定1. 短期目标(1-2 年):例如掌握一门新的前端框架或技术,提升代码质量和效率,在现有工作中取得显著成果。
2. 中期目标(3-5 年):可能是晋升到更高职位(如技术主管),负责更大规模的项目,或者拓展相关领域的知识(如移动端开发)。
3. 长期目标(5 年以上):比如成为前端领域专家,在行业内有一定影响力,或者进入管理层,带领团队等。
三、技能提升1. 持续学习最新的前端技术和趋势,如 Vue.js、React、Webpack 等的更新版本。
2. 深入学习相关领域,如 UI/UX 设计、后端技术等,增强全栈能力。
3. 提高代码规范和可维护性,学习代码重构和优化技巧。
四、项目经验积累1. 主动争取参与重要项目,锻炼解决复杂问题的能力。
2. 尝试不同类型的项目,拓宽业务视野。
3. 在项目中注重团队协作和沟通,提升领导力。
五、拓展人脉1. 参加行业会议、技术论坛等活动,结识同行和专家。
2. 加入前端技术社区,积极交流和分享经验。
3. 利用社交媒体建立专业形象,扩大影响力。
六、获得认证1. 考取相关的前端技术认证,提升自己的竞争力。
2. 参加一些权威的培训课程,获取专业认可。
七、管理能力培养1. 如果有向管理方向发展的打算,学习项目管理、团队管理知识。
2. 锻炼决策能力、沟通协调能力和领导力。
八、工作机会1. 关注市场动态,适时寻找更适合自己发展的工作机会。
2. 准备好高质量的简历和面试技巧,展示自己的优势和潜力。
九、生活平衡1. 注意保持工作和生活的平衡,避免过度劳累。
2. 培养健康的生活习惯,以良好的状态应对工作挑战。
定期回顾和调整自己的规划,根据实际情况和新的机遇进行灵活修改,确保始终朝着自己的目标前进。
对于 31 岁的前端开发者,以下是一些制定有效职业发展规划策略的建议:
自我评估:1. 明确自身优势和不足,包括技术能力、沟通能力、团队协作能力等。
2. 分析自己的兴趣点和职业倾向,确定更适合的前端细分领域或发展方向。
技术提升:1. 关注前端技术的最新趋势和发展,如 Vue、React、Angular 等框架的更新,以及 WebAssembly、PWA 等新技术。
2. 深入学习至少一种主流框架,达到精通水平。
3. 提升代码质量和性能优化能力。
4. 掌握相关的后端技术知识,拓宽技术视野。
项目经验:1. 争取参与大型、复杂项目,提升项目管理和解决复杂问题的能力。
2. 主动承担关键任务和技术挑战,展现自己的价值。
拓展技能:1. 学习设计相关知识,提升界面设计和用户体验能力。
2. 掌握数据分析和可视化技能,以便更好地与数据相关项目结合。
团队协作与领导力:1. 加强团队沟通和协作能力,提升团队影响力。
2. 尝试带领小团队,培养领导能力。
开源贡献:1. 参与开源项目,提升技术影响力和知名度。
建立人脉:1. 积极参加行业会议、技术交流活动,结识同行和专家。
2. 利用社交媒体和专业平台拓展人脉。
学历提升:如有需要,可以考虑攻读在职研究生等提升学历。
职业目标设定:1. 确定短期(1-2 年)、中期(3-5 年)和长期(5 年以上)的职业目标,如成为技术专家、团队领导、架构师等。
2. 根据目标制定具体的行动计划。
工作机会:1. 关注市场动态,适时寻找更适合自己发展的工作机会。
2. 准备好有竞争力的简历和面试技巧。
持续学习:1. 养成持续学习的习惯,保持对新技术的敏感度。
2. 定期回顾和调整职业发展规划。
对于 31 岁制定有效的前端职业发展规划,可以考虑以下几个方面:
一、自我评估1. 明确自身技能水平,包括对各种前端技术的掌握程度。
2. 分析自己的优势,如技术专长、沟通能力、团队协作能力等。
3. 了解自己的不足和有待提升的领域。
二、目标设定1. 确定短期(1-2 年)、中期(3-5 年)和长期(5 年以上)的职业目标,例如晋升职位、薪资增长幅度、掌握特定技术等。
2. 思考是否希望向技术专家方向发展,还是往管理方向转型。
三、技能提升1. 持续学习最新的前端技术和框架,如 Vue、React、Angular 等的更新版本。
2. 深入学习相关领域知识,如 UI/UX 设计、后端开发等,拓宽技术视野。
3. 提升代码质量和开发效率,学习代码优化、自动化测试等技能。
四、项目经验1. 主动争取参与重要、有挑战性的项目,积累大型项目经验。
2. 在项目中承担更多责任,展现自己的能力。
五、拓展人脉1. 积极参加行业会议、技术论坛等活动,结识同行和专家。
2. 利用社交媒体和专业平台拓展人脉资源。
六、获得认证1. 考取相关的前端技术认证,提升自己的竞争力。
七、管理能力培养(若有管理方向意向)
1. 学习项目管理、团队管理知识和技能。
2. 锻炼领导能力和沟通协调能力。
八、工作机会1. 关注市场动态,适时寻找更适合自己发展的工作机会。
2. 准备好优秀的简历和面试技巧,以更好地展示自己。
九、工作生活平衡1. 确保在追求职业发展的同时,保持健康的生活方式和良好的心态。
2. 合理安排时间,兼顾家庭和个人兴趣爱好。
定期回顾和调整自己的职业发展规划,根据实际情况和变化做出适当的修改和完善,以确保始终朝着自己的目标前进。
以下是一份关于前端个人职业规划的示例,你可以根据自己的实际情况进行调整和完善:
《前端个人职业规划》一、随着互联网技术的不断发展,前端开发在整个软件开发领域中扮演着越来越重要的角色。为了在前端领域取得良好的职业发展,制定一份清晰、可行的职业规划是至关重要的。
二、自我分析1. 技能评估:具备扎实的 HTML、CSS、JavaScript 基础,熟悉常见的前端框架和工具。
2. 优势:较强的学习能力、逻辑思维能力和解决问题的能力;对新技术充满好奇心。
3. 劣势:在某些复杂业务场景下的经验不足;沟通协作能力有待进一步提高。
三、职业目标短期目标(1-2 年):- 深入学习主流前端框架,提升代码质量和开发效率。
- 参与多个项目,积累不同类型项目的经验。
- 提高团队协作能力。中期目标(3-5 年):- 成为团队中的核心前端开发人员,能够独立承担复杂项目的前端开发工作。
- 掌握至少一种后端语言,拓展全栈开发能力。
- 获得相关的专业认证。长期目标(5 年以上):- 晋升为前端技术专家或团队领导,带领团队进行技术创新和项目开发。
- 参与行业交流,提升个人影响力。
- 关注行业前沿技术,为公司的技术发展方向提供建议。
四、行动计划1. 短期行动:- 制定学习计划,每月学习一个新的前端技术知识点。
- 积极参与项目,主动承担更多责任。
- 参加团队内部的技术分享会。
2. 中期行动:- 利用业余时间学习后端语言,通过实践项目巩固。
- 参与开源项目,提升技术水平和知名度。
- 参加行业培训和研讨会。
3. 长期行动:- 持续关注行业动态,不断更新知识和技能。
- 培养领导能力,学习管理知识。
- 建立个人技术博客或社交媒体账号,分享技术经验。
五、评估与调整定期对自己的职业规划进行评估,根据实际情况进行调整。例如,如果发现自己在某些方面进展缓慢,可以适当增加学习时间和投入;如果行业技术发生重大变化,及时调整学习方向和目标。
六、通过明确个人职业规划,我将更加有目标地进行学习和工作,不断提升自己的能力和价值,为实现自己在前端领域的职业理想而努力奋斗。
以上内容仅供参考,你可以根据自身具体情况进行修改和完善,使其更符合你的个人发展需求。